Cebu (siːˈbuː)

Cebu is an island province in the Philippines, consisting of the main island itself and 167 surrounding islands and islets. Its capital is Cebu City, the oldest city in the Philippines, which forms part of the Cebu Metropolitan Area together with four neighboring cities.

Etymology

The name "Cebu" came from the old Cebuano word sibu or sibo ("trade"), a shortened form of sinibuayng hingpit ("the place for trading"). It was originally applied to the harbours of the town of Sugbu, the ancient name for Cebu City.

Related Terms

  • Cebuano - The language spoken in Cebu and other parts of the Philippines.
  • Cebu City - The capital city of the province of Cebu.
  • Sugbu - The ancient name for Cebu City.
  • Sinulog Festival - An annual cultural and religious festival held on the third Sunday of January in Cebu City.
  • Mactan Island - An island part of Cebu province, known for its historic significance and tourism.
  • Visayas - The group of islands in the central part of the Philippines where Cebu is located.
